Kangle是一款强大的Web服务器软件,它能够提供高性能的Web服务以及DNS服务等,在CDN(Content Delivery Network, 内容分发网络)部署中,SSL证书的安装是提升网站安全性的重要一环,以下将详细解析如何在使用Kangle部署的CDN上部署SSL证书:
1、准备服务器及环境
安装Kangle:首先需要在所有CDN节点上安装Kangle和EP控制面板,可以通过Kangle一键脚本进行快捷安装,该脚本支持多种PHP版本以及MySQL,并且具备CDN专属安装模式。
同步服务器版本:为了保持系统的稳定性,最好确认所有CDN节点上的Easypanel控制面板为相同版本,示例中使用的版本为2.6.28。
2、配置SSL证书
申请SSL证书:需要先申请SSL证书,可以通过https://buy.wosign.com/ 进行申请。
开启443端口:在Kangle主机上开启443端口,这是SSL证书使用的特有端口。
设置端口及虚拟主机:在Easypanel后台填写端口设置,包括80和443s,并在虚拟主机管理面板中选择SSL证书进行配置。
3、配置多节点CDN系统
智能解析与宕机检测:对绑定在主控服务器上的域名进行智能解析和宕机检测设置,确保CDN系统的高可用性。
增加节点:在主控服务器上通过Easypanel管理员控制面板,进入“其他设置——多节点CDN设置”内添加各个服务器节点。
4、使用CDN系统服务
CNAME域名解析:进行CNAME域名解析,允许多个名字映射到同一台计算机。
5、管理与监控
登陆主节点服务器:通过登录到主节点服务器的管理后台,可以对整个CDN系统的状态进行监控和管理。
添加辅助节点:在管理界面中添加辅助节点,确保每个节点都正确配置和连接。
在深入配置Kangle服务器和CDN时,应当注意以下几点:
确保各节点服务器时间同步,避免由于时间差异引起的日志错误或认证失败。
定期检查SSL证书的有效期并及时更新,避免因证书过期导致用户访问受影响。
考虑使用负载均衡技术以优化CDN性能,确保请求被平均分配到每个节点。
安全方面,除了SSL证书外,还需要关注服务器的安全设置,比如防火墙规则和权限设置等。
部署带有SSL证书的Kangle CDN系统需要综合运用服务器设置、证书配置、智能解析、节点管理等多方面的技术,通过详细的步骤和注意事项,可以建立一个既快速又安全的CDN网络,以提供更佳的用户体验和数据安全。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/801703.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复